Distinct contributions of LRRC8A and its paralogs to the VSOR anion channel from those of the ASOR anion channel
Volume- and acid-sensitive outwardly rectifying anion channels (VSOR and ASOR) activated by swelling and acidification exhibit voltage-dependent inactivation and activation time courses, respectively.
